The Role of Phlebotomists in Health Care
Phlebotomists play an essential function in the health care system, working as the important web link between patients and essential analysis testing. You'll carry out blood draws, making certain examples are gathered precisely and safely. Your competence assists in diagnosing medical conditions, keeping track of health and wellness, and directing treatment choices.In your day-to-day communications, you'll need to develop depend on with individuals, making them feel comfortable during what might be a demanding experience. You are accountable for labeling and handling examples meticulously to avoid contamination or errors, which can affect test results.
Past this, you'll commonly function alongside physicians and registered nurses, communicating vital details about clients' problems. Your duty is basic in maintaining the workflow in health care setups, making certain timely and precise results. By grasping your abilities, you add meaningfully to patient care, making you an indispensable part of the medical group. Welcoming this responsibility is essential to your success as a phlebotomist.

Numerous kinds of training programs are offered for those wanting to become proficient in phlebotomy. You can select from certification programs, which normally last a few months and focus on important abilities. There are additionally diploma programs that supply a more thorough education, frequently lasting up to a year. If you're trying to find a deeper understanding, an associate level in an associated field may be the ideal fit. Online training courses provide flexibility for those stabilizing work or family members commitments, permitting you to examine at your very own speed. Additionally, some hospitals and facilities provide on-the-job training programs, giving functional experience while you learn. Whatever course you select, each program aims to furnish you with the necessary abilities for a successful phlebotomy occupation.

Qualification and Licensing Requirements
Prior to you can begin your job in phlebotomy, it is important to comprehend the qualification and licensing requirements that vary by state. A lot of states Read More Here call for phlebotomists to hold a qualification from an identified company, such as the National Phlebotomy Association or the American Culture for Scientific Pathology. These certifications usually include passing an examination that examines your understanding and abilities in the field.Along with certification, some states have particular licensing demands. You might need to complete a specific number of hours in scientific method, send proof of training, or go through a background check. It is essential to research your state's policies to make sure you satisfy all required requirements.
Staying informed about these requirements not just aids you safeguard a placement yet likewise improves your reputation as a specialist. By meeting these demands, you'll be well on your method to a successful career in phlebotomy.
Hands-On Training and Practical Experience
Hands-on training and practical experience are essential parts of your phlebotomy education and learning, as they permit you to use theoretical knowledge in real-world scenarios. Throughout your training, you'll take part in supervised venipuncture, learn correct strategies, and end up being aware of various blood collection equipment. This straight participation is vital for developing your self-confidence and refining your skills.You'll work very closely with skilled professionals that can lead you with the nuances of person communication and sample handling. Each session not just strengthens your understanding but additionally prepares you for the fast-paced environment of medical care setups.
Furthermore, many programs include scientific rotations, permitting you to experience diverse setups, from health centers to outpatient clinics. This direct exposure assists you adjust to different obstacles and individual needs, guaranteeing you're well-prepared for your future role. Accept these opportunities, as they're crucial to ending up being a proficient and thoughtful phlebotomist.
